MASON CITY – They allegedly stood on top of one car and proceeded to swing a bat downward in a violent fashion, striking the windshield until it shattered.

This vehicle and others incurred serious damage early Wednesday morning at the hands of at least two teens, who may have been drunk, NIT is told, and have been arrested but can’t be named due to a state law.

This morning, a 16-year-old male juvenile and a 15-year-old male juvenile were arrested for allegedly damaging multiple vehicles parked in the Highlands neighborhood in northeast Mason City. There appear to be at least 3 vehicles that were dented or had windows broken out. Mason City police are awaiting damage estimates. Combined damage is easily over $1,000.00, they say.

The 2 males were arrested in the 1500 block of North Hampshire at 3:07 separately before 4:00 AM. The 16-year-old was outside a residence and the 15-year-old was located inside the residence. Officers contacted the younger boy’s parent(s) and asked that a parent come home. The juvenile’s parent was cooperative and came to the scene. Police then took the 15-year-old teen into custody from inside the residence at approx 3:56 AM.

Most of the damaged vehicles appear to be located in the same area that the juveniles were arrested and the 700 block of 15th Place NE. No one else is being sought at this time – police believe only these two were involved.

Both juveniles were charged with Unlawful Consumption; 2nd Degree Criminal Mischief; 3rd Degree Criminal Mischief; and 4th Degree Criminal Mischief. The 16-year-old was released to JCS staff and the 15-year-old was released to a parent.

A victim of the vandalism spree told NIT this morning that one car “got it worse .. they were on the roof” swinging a bat at the car’s windows.

“The cops said they were (about) 16 years old and drunk,” the alleged victim continued. “A neighbor who was an old cop heard the commotion because they tried to bust his windows and left and I guess he came out and followed them after they did my windows … they went around the corner to the white car and was vandalizing that car and the guy yelled at them and the kids took off and went through the back yards and they watched them walk into the house.”
